HoA Management Act 2025 bill comes into effect today
The Speaker of the Fifth House of Assembly, Corine N. George-Massicote, endorsed the bill, stating, "This is a proud and defining moment in the parliamentary history of the Virgin Islands, as it represents a significant step forward in strengthening our democratic institutions."
Bill supported & championed by members
The Speaker emphasised that the bill was supported and championed by Members of the House of Assembly due to its importance in enhancing the Virgin Islands' democracy. It aims to make the Legislature more independent, modern, and accountable.
In a press statement, it was indicated that this legislation is historic in several respects since it is the first bill in the Virgin Islands to be introduced by a Member of the House and passed without proceeding through Cabinet, thereby affirming the constitutional role of the Legislature as a coequal branch of Government.
Aglins with modern parliamentary systems
This new bill also seeks to create a semi-autonomous management structure for the House of Assembly, providing the institutional support necessary for the Legislature to function with professionalism, efficiency, and independence, in line with parliamentary best practices throughout the Commonwealth.
According to the statement, “The passage of this legislation is especially significant as the House of Assembly marks and celebrates its 75th year.”
This legislation not only commemorates the past but also prepares the territory for the future by ensuring that the House of Assembly has the necessary tools to meet the demands of modern governance while safeguarding the integrity of parliamentary democracy.
The Speaker commended the members of this Fifth House, parliamentary staff, and all stakeholders who contributed to this important achievement.
"This moment stands as a testament to what is possible when we place the institution above politics and commit ourselves to the long-term strengthening of our democratic foundations," the speaker added.
